Vaping: Risks and Realities

Despite advertising campaigns portraying vapes as a safe choice to smoking , the rising body of evidence reveals significant health dangers . While often presented as containing less harmful substances than conventional cigarettes , vaping subjects users to a variety of concerning ingredients , including the drug nicotine which is very addictive . Furthermore , the long-term health impacts of vaping remain uncertain, and emerging data indicates links to respiratory problems and other severe health ailments. Consequently , it's crucial for individuals to be aware of the actual dangers before starting electronic devices.

Vaping and Your Well-being : What You Need Be Aware Of

The rising prevalence of vaping has left many individuals questioning its impact on their health . While often marketed as a safer to regular cigarettes, the reality is that vaping presents a number of possible health risks . New research suggests a association between vaping and breathing issues, including bronchiolitis , and may harm cardiovascular function . Furthermore, the delayed health effects of vaping are still largely unknown, creating ambiguity among scientific professionals. It's crucial to recognize that nicotine , often found in vaping solutions , is highly addictive .
